Plan Interclass Basketball Teams

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

A meeting of all men interested in the formation of interclass basketball teams among the three upper classes in the University will be held in the Hemenway gymnasium Monday afternoon at 3 o'clock, it was announced last night by D. J. Kelly, Assistant Director of Physical Education. There will also be a similar meeting at 4 o'clock of all graduate students interested in forming graduate school basketball teams.

In former years interclass basketball has always been organized at the close of the regular basketball season, and very little attention has been paid to it. By forming interclass teams early in the fall Mr. Relly hopes to arouse more interest in interclass athletics.
